Output 2676b5427ae3315a804605e958836a99dd451fbe67236b2db1327ce32f31f4ad: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 6cf51c5ba78bfd171b9b35a92e3415f62efb39e6
address
bc1qdn63cka83073wxumxk5judq47ch0kw0xxmt6ax
transaction
2676b5427ae3315a804605e958836a99dd451fbe67236b2db1327ce32f31f4ad